Nest Thermostat Wiring Base

Nest Thermostat Wiring Base is a crucial component of any Nest thermostat system. It serves as the connection point for the thermostat to the heating and cooling system in your home. Without a properly installed and functioning wiring base, the thermostat will not be able to communicate with your HVAC system effectively.

Importance of Nest Thermostat Wiring Base

  • Provides the necessary connections for the Nest thermostat to control your heating and cooling system.
  • Ensures proper communication between the thermostat and HVAC system for efficient operation.
  • Allows for easy installation and setup of the thermostat in your home.

Reading and Interpreting Nest Thermostat Wiring Base

When installing or troubleshooting a Nest thermostat system, it is essential to understand how to read and interpret the wiring base. Each terminal on the base corresponds to a specific function in your heating and cooling system. Here are some key points to keep in mind:

  • Refer to the wiring diagram provided by Nest to identify the correct terminals for each wire.
  • Make sure to match the wires from your HVAC system to the corresponding terminals on the wiring base.
  • Double-check your connections to ensure they are secure and properly seated in the terminals.

Using Nest Thermostat Wiring Base for Troubleshooting

One of the benefits of having a Nest thermostat system is the ability to troubleshoot electrical problems easily. The wiring base allows you to access the connections between the thermostat and HVAC system, making it easier to identify and resolve issues. Here’s how you can use the wiring base for troubleshooting:

  • Check for loose or damaged wires in the terminals of the wiring base.
  • Use a multimeter to test the continuity of the wires and ensure they are carrying electrical current properly.
  • Refer to the wiring diagram to confirm that the wires are connected to the correct terminals.

When working with electrical systems and wiring diagrams, it is crucial to prioritize safety. Here are some safety tips and best practices to keep in mind:

  • Always turn off the power to your HVAC system before working on the wiring base.
  • Use insulated tools to prevent electric shock.
  • Avoid touching bare wires with your hands and always wear gloves when handling electrical components.
  • If you are unsure about any aspect of the installation or troubleshooting process, consult a professional electrician or HVAC technician.
